Wexford Soccer Club is a not-for-profit organization with a long and storied history in the Toronto soccer community. The Club was established in 1967 and has since become the longest running soccer club in Scarborough. With a focus on both house league and representative teams, Wexford caters to players of all ages and skill levels, providing a nurturing and competitive environment for its members.
The Club operates out of Birchmount Stadium in Scarborough and has seen its teams achieve success in both league and cup competitions across its six divisions. Over the years, Wexford's representative teams have earned numerous Provincial and National championships, showcasing the Club's commitment to fostering talent and developing young athletes.
